ABSTRACT

BACKGROUND: 'Walk for Life' (WFL) is the sustainable clubfoot program in Bangladesh, where there are many challenges in implementing the Ponseti technique in a poor and highly populated country. The relapsing tendency of congenital clubfoot deformity means that initial results may well differ from those of the medium and longer term. Over 10000 children with16668 clubfeet have been treated by WFL since its inception in 2009. Such a large project provides both the need to evaluate each individual child's case, and also the opportunity to evaluate the wider WFL program results. Such systematic review requires a measure that is sufficiently robust, yet contextually practical, hence the aim of this work was to develop a tool for this purpose, and to report the examiner reliability. METHODS: The Bangla clubfoot tool was largely developed from components of existing validated clubfoot assessment measures, and adapted for local use. Three areas of examination are included: parent satisfaction, gait, clinical examination of the clubfoot. A same-subject repeated measures study design was used to assess the intra-rater reliability of a local WFL physiotherapist, and a visiting WFL volunteer. The inter-rater reliability was also assessed, which is relevant for other examiners and other clubfoot projects undertaking evaluation of medium and longer term results. RESULTS: The reliability study was conducted in 37 children who had commenced treatment for congenital clubfoot deformity using Ponseti method within the previous two years. The mean age of the children was 2.6 years, with gender 28 male: 9 female. The intra-rater reliability results [ICCs (95% CI)] were: 0.87 (0.76 - 0.93) for the local WFL examiner, and 0.82 (0.64 - 0.91) for the visiting examiner. Inter-rater reliability results [ICCs (95% CI)] were: 0.92 (0.88 - 0.96). Hence the tool showed very good intra-rater and inter-rater reliability, rendering it suitable for use. CONCLUSIONS: The Bangla clubfoot tool has been developed to suit the context of the large WFL clubfoot program in Bangladesh, and shown to be a very reliable evaluation instrument.

ABSTRACT

BACKGROUND: Bangladesh is one of the most populous countries in the world at 160 million with 1/3 existing below the poverty line. With an annual birth rate of approximately 3.2 million, an estimated incidence of 1:900 live births, the country has approximately 5000 new cases of idiopathic congenital talipes equinovarus per annum. The Bangladesh sustainable clubfoot program, Walk for Life (WFL), was conceived to respond to this unmet need. METHODS: WFL started in 2009 and has rapidly grown to 35 clinics. Overseas experts initially increased local capacity by training a team of national paramedical staff. Government support enabled integration with the public hospital system and enhanced sustainability. WFL has supplied materials, educational, administrative, and clinical support throughout. All recruited cases underwent Ponseti casting. Demographic, Pirani scores, cast, tenotomy, and bracing data have been prospectively collected from all patients. Detailed review has been undertaken for 1040 patients after 12 months of treatment in 3 divisions of Bangladesh. RESULTS: Between 2009 and 2011, 6069 feet (3922 patients) were recruited to the project. Of these 1643 feet (1040 patients) have completed a minimum of 1-year follow-up. The male:female ratio was 2.7:1 with a mean age of 22 months at presentation (range, 0 to 36). Typical idiopathic congenital talipes equinovarus responded in a median of 5 casts (range, 1 to 25) with 76% undergoing tenotomy. Thirteen percent were atypical feet requiring a median of 5 casts. The percentage of patients missing at the 12-month point was 12%. Two percent of patients experienced complications. CONCLUSIONS: The Bangladesh clubfoot program demonstrates that rapid case ascertainment is possible in a developing world setting with appropriate logistical support. The use of local physiotherapists and paramedics yielded good clinical outcomes in an environment with full access to clinical review and ongoing training. A higher than expected number of atypical cases have been noted, requiring modified Ponseti treatment. Complications have been few at this early stage. LEVEL OF EVIDENCE: Level 2-therapeutic study.
